Understanding the Main Costs in Wholesale Wheelchair Orders

Every wholesale order has several parts. Knowing each one helps you build a realistic total. Here is a simple breakdown:

  • Product Unit Price: This is the cost per wheelchair.

  • Minimum Order Quantity (MOQ): Most factories ask for 100 units or more to keep production efficient.

  • Shipping and Logistics: Ocean freight, insurance, and local delivery.

  • Customs and Duties: Taxes that vary by country.

  • Accessories and Customization: Extra fees for colors, logos, or special features.

  • After-Sales Support: Warranty and training (sometimes free from good suppliers).

To make this clearer, here is a helpful table based on typical wholesale experiences:

Type of WheelchairTypical Wholesale Price per UnitSuggested Starting MOQExtra Costs to Add (approx.)
Basic Manual Steel Model$40 – $80100 unitsShipping $2,000–$4,000 per container
Lightweight Aluminum Folding$80 – $150100–200 unitsCustoms 10–15% + accessories $5–$15
Reclining or Commode Model$120 – $250100 unitsHigher due to extra features
Electric/Power Wheelchair$350 – $60050–100 unitsBattery shipping rules apply
New 2025 Ultra-Light Travel Model$90 – $180100 unitsMinimal; great for quick sales

These numbers come from real factory production data and help you estimate totals. For example, a 100-unit order of lightweight aluminum wheelchairs might cost $10,000–$15,000 for the products plus $3,000 for shipping. Your total landed cost would be around $130–$180 per unit.

Key Factors That Influence Pricing from Wheelchairs Manufacturers

Several things change the final price. Understanding them lets you make smart choices.

1. Materials and Build Quality Aluminum frames cost more than steel but weigh less and last longer. Our lightweight models use high-grade aluminum that passes strict tests. Customers love them because they fold easily and feel sturdy. Higher-quality materials mean happier end users and fewer returns for you.

2. Features and Customization Basic models are cheapest. Add reclining backs, commode seats, shock-absorbing wheels, or quick-fold designs and the price rises. The good news? Customization often pays for itself through faster sales. Many of our distributors choose our new reclining travel models because they sell well to seniors and travelers.

3. Order Volume Larger orders usually bring lower unit prices. We often give better rates for repeat customers or full container loads. This is one way experienced suppliers reward loyal partners.

4. Certifications and Testing CE, FDA, and ISO 13485 marks cost extra to achieve, but they open doors to big markets. When you buy from a certified durable medical equipment manufacturer, you avoid expensive delays at customs.

5. Lead Time and Delivery Speed Rush orders cost more. Planning ahead saves money. Our factory uses an efficient system to keep lead times between 7 and 60 days, depending on the order.

By thinking about these factors early, you can decide which features truly matter for your customers and stay within budget.

Step-by-Step Guide to Calculating Your Wholesale Budget

Follow these simple steps and you will feel more confident:

  1. Define Your Market Needs Talk to local hospitals, care homes, or online buyers. Decide which models will sell best—lightweight travel chairs or heavy-duty options?

  2. Set Your Target Selling Price Decide how much profit you want per unit. Add your desired margin to the landed cost.

  3. Estimate Total Order Size Start with 100–200 units to test. Use the table above to calculate product cost.

  4. Add Shipping and Fees Request a quote for sea freight. Remember insurance and local delivery.

  5. Include Buffer for Customs Add 10–20 percent extra for duties and unexpected charges.

  6. Factor in Marketing and Storage Leave room for advertising and warehouse space.

  7. Review and Adjust Compare suppliers. Ask for volume discounts.

When you finish these steps, you will have a clear number. Many of our partners tell us this process helped them grow without stress.
